This visitor center, dedicated to a life-long Yellville resident, is also the home of the local Chamber of Commerce. There is a gift shop inside chock-full of local souvenirs and other locally-made products, and questions are cheerfully answered.

This visitor center is easily identified as you come into town from the west by the red MoPac caboose, sitting outside the restored and relocated Yellville depot, which serves as the actual visitor center.
